Official: Levski Sofia complete deal for former Golden Eaglets central defender
Published: July 08, 2024With a statement on their official website, Bulgarian top-flight club Levski Sofia have announced the signing of former Nigeria U17 international Clement Ikenna.
The 21-year-old ended his association with Croatian club NK Dubrava ZG after putting pen to paper on a three-year contract with Levski Sofia, until the summer of 2027.
Per club policy, Levski Sofia have not disclosed the fee they paid for the acquisition of the talented Nigerian central defender.
Ikenna was one of the standout players for the Golden Eaglets at the 2019 U17 Africa Cup of Nations and Fifa U17 World Cup, going the distance in nine consecutive matches during the tournaments held in Tanzania and Brazil respectively.
The Port Harcourt-born player began his career in Europe with the academy team of NK Zagorec and in the summer of 2022 he moved to another Croatian club NK Dubrava ZG.
Ikenna made 61 appearances in all competitions for NK Dubrava ZG, scoring three goals in 5,282 minutes of action.
During his unveiling ceremony, he was presented with the number 30 jersey.
Levski Sofia, 26-time champions of Bulgaria, begin the season with a derby clash against Lokomotiv Sofia on July 20.
Garba Lawal, Omonigho Temile, Justice Christopher, Richard Eromoigbe, Ekundayo Jayeoba, and Tunde Adeniji are all former players of Levski Sofia.
